Output 20821218ea260bc39e2c60773681a2d32875c78be229a7a7d137dc7b00556f92:104

value
1817065
script pubkey
OP_0 OP_PUSHBYTES_32 e6682a52a00e75ac507e28e139bf4c8162a5a0274e446334b75b4e53fbc8084f
address
bc1que5z554qpe66c5r79rsnn06vs932tgp8fezxxd9htd89877gpp8suepha3
transaction
20821218ea260bc39e2c60773681a2d32875c78be229a7a7d137dc7b00556f92
spent
true